Heidelberg Materials North America, previously known as Lehigh Hanson, operates more than 450 locations with approximately 9,000 employees in the U.S. and Canada. Heidelberg Materials seeks to future proof its cement operations with increased digitization and operational capability. The overarching goal is to centralize operations, and to achieve operational excellence. For this purpose, it is establishing the Heidelberg Materials Remote Optimization Center (HROC) in its headquarters in Irving, Texas. As an HROC Systems Engineer, you will be responsible for providing technical support and expertise to multiple cement plants within a designated region. Based in a central location remote to the plants, you will collaborate closely with plant teams to optimize process performance, troubleshoot issues, and drive continuous improvement initiatives across the region. Occasional travel to the plant sites supported will be required. Apply today!What you will be doingSummary: Cencora is seeking a skilled and experienced Storage and Backup Engineer Level 2 to join our 24/7 IT Operations team – IT Command Center (ITCC). This global ITCC team works in follow-the-sun model operating out of 3 regions – APAC, EMEA, and AMER, supporting Cencora core infrastructure services comprising of Network/AD, Server, Virtualization, Storage & Backup solutions. This position is responsible for working from AMER region in a shift schedule, supporting high availability production systems in an exceptionally large enterprise-grade environment with multiple global data centers. The ideal candidate will have considerable experience working with storage SAN, NAS, backup, and archive products while collaborating closely with cross-functional teams and SMEs/Engineering teams.The candidate will be responsible for day-to-day operations including monitoring and management, remote infrastructure/hardware management, software updates and upgrades, availability and performance management, inputs to capacity planning.
